EC&I Design Engineer
About this role
As an EC&I Design Engineer, you will be responsible for delivering assigned project tasks, conducting technical research, and producing high-quality engineering reports. You will interpret design requirements, apply engineering principles, and demonstrate initiative by developing innovative and practical solutions. You will utilise your technical knowledge to develop and interpret engineering drawings, data, and documentation in support of the design, installation, testing, commissioning, maintenance, fault diagnosis, overhaul, and decommissioning of electrical and data systems within engineering infrastructure projects.
Your responsibilities will encompass a wide range of engineering systems, including: Low Voltage (LV) Distribution Systems Extra Low Voltage (ELV) Systems Control and Automation Systems Instrumentation and Monitoring Systems Sensors and Transmitters Auxiliary Electrical Systems The role requires proficiency in the use of both standard and specialist electrical equipment, machinery, hand tools, measuring instruments, diagnostic equipment, and computer-aided design (CAD) software.
You will ensure that all components and assemblies are designed and delivered in accordance with project specifications, industry standards, and quality requirements. Duties will include: Provide technical expertise and guidance on Electrical, Control, and Instrumentation (EC&I) systems to support the wider design team. Develop, review, and interpret electrical and instrumentation design documentation, including: Single Line Diagrams (SLDs) Block Cable Diagrams Instrument Loop Diagrams Hook-Up Drawings Equipment Layouts General Arrangement (GA) Drawings Perform electrical design calculations and produce supporting documentation, including cable sizing and fault level calculations using AMTECH ProDesign and lighting calculations using DIALux.
